00031 #ifndef PX_PHYSICS_NXMATERIAL
00032 #define PX_PHYSICS_NXMATERIAL
00033 
00037 #include "PxPhysX.h"
00038 #include "PxMaterialFlags.h"
00039 #include "common/PxSerialFramework.h"
00040 
00041 #ifndef PX_DOXYGEN
00042 namespace physx
00043 {
00044 #endif
00045 
00046 class PxScene;
00047 
00048 class PxMaterial : public PxSerializable
00049 {
00050 public:
00051 
00062     virtual     void            release() = 0;
00063 
00072     virtual PxU32               getReferenceCount() const = 0;
00073 
00085     virtual     void            setDynamicFriction(PxReal coef) = 0;
00086 
00094     virtual     PxReal          getDynamicFriction() const = 0;
00095 
00107     virtual     void            setStaticFriction(PxReal coef) = 0;
00108 
00115     virtual     PxReal          getStaticFriction() const = 0;
00116 
00128     virtual     void            setRestitution(PxReal rest) = 0;
00129 
00139     virtual     PxReal          getRestitution() const = 0;
00140 
00152     virtual     void            setFlag(PxMaterialFlag::Enum flag, bool) = 0;
00153 
00154 
00163     virtual     void            setFlags( PxMaterialFlags inFlags ) = 0;
00164 
00172     virtual     PxMaterialFlags getFlags() const = 0;
00173 
00185     virtual     void            setFrictionCombineMode(PxCombineMode::Enum combMode) = 0;
00186 
00196     virtual     PxCombineMode::Enum getFrictionCombineMode() const = 0;
00197 
00209     virtual     void            setRestitutionCombineMode(PxCombineMode::Enum combMode) = 0;
00210 
00220     virtual     PxCombineMode::Enum getRestitutionCombineMode() const = 0;
00221 
00222     //public variables:
00223                 void*           userData;   
00224 
00225     virtual     const char*     getConcreteTypeName() const                 {   return "PxMaterial"; }
00226 
00227 protected:
00228                                 PxMaterial(PxRefResolver& v) :  PxSerializable(v)   {}
00229     PX_INLINE                   PxMaterial() : userData(NULL)       {}
00230     virtual                     ~PxMaterial()                       {}
00231     virtual     bool            isKindOf(const char* name)  const       {   return !strcmp("PxMaterial", name) || PxSerializable::isKindOf(name); }
00232 
00233 };
00234 
00235 #ifndef PX_DOXYGEN
00236 } // namespace physx
00237 #endif
00238 
00240 #endif
